Transaction 159e2308e9fa80e039ee2d93fd6c62a7268904390dcfe9108a9761689e364c0f
1 Input
1 Output
-
159e2308e9fa80e039ee2d93fd6c62a7268904390dcfe9108a9761689e364c0f:0
- value
- 81078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c173b4ea5f7bd95a534bae156318a07744000512 OP_EQUAL
- address
- 3KKtx1WSZrKtbg7FL2A5QbNyxs6WrDCnj1